Output 7395da3c0d7de79b96ecd884321b4df607b8cacbd1f52fc908782773d84de145:0

value
304989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 444ecf329026c782691d4f264bfcbbaa8918fa29 OP_EQUALVERIFY OP_CHECKSIG
address
17EBMpHDUXqUYaLMqkgXo96zWBcrULCunY
transaction
7395da3c0d7de79b96ecd884321b4df607b8cacbd1f52fc908782773d84de145
spent
true